Erotic Book Review



The Pet Shop by KD Grace


Review by Kay Jaybee


After the rave reviews, regular erotic explosions, and worldwide battery shortage that followed the publication of KD Grace’s amazing first novel, The Initiation of Miss Holly, there may well have been a few out there who wondered how on earth Ms Grace could follow such a sizzling hit.

The answer has arrived in the shape of The Pet Shop, which I’m delighted to report is every bit as hot its predecessor. 

Stella James loves her job to the point where she has become a workaholic. An accidental admission to her boss however, confessing she has no real life outside work, let alone a social or sex life, leads to her being given a gift for her outstanding service. A gift that will change her life.

Forget hampers of chocolates, spa tokens or a day trip to France, this gift is something special. This gift is a pet; a pet which will belong to her for an entire weekend, to look after, tend, and exercise. A male pet. A naked human male pet called Tino who wants sex, food, company, and absolutely no conversation whatsoever. After all, pets don’t talk.

Once she has gotten over her initial shock and shyness at receiving such an upfront and risqué present, Stella begins to relax and enjoy the services that The Pet Shop and its pets can offer.
Vincent Evanston is a powerful philanthropist, who Stella encounters by chance in a forest while on a business trip. Handsome, rich and self assured, Vincent happens to bear a striking resemblance to Tino, leading Stella to believe that Vincent and Tino are one and the same. Vincent however, is admitting nothing.

Increasingly preoccupied with proving that her theory is correct, Stella becomes obsessed with both Vincent and The Pet Shop. As her investigations continue, Stella is determined to stop at nothing until she gets the answer to the question that dominates her life – is Tino really Vincent? 

A satisfying mix of romance, kink, and inventive S&M, The Pet Shop reels the reader in, neatly side stepping clichés, and forcing you to read just one more chapter before you put it down.

I particularly like the excellent use of temptingly fun bodily descriptions that are a blessed relief from the norm. My personal favorite has to be after Stella is fitted with a leather pony harness (I’m not going to say why- it would spoil things for you), “...A band of leather attached to the collar connected to another strip, were twisted and crisscrossed around Stella’s breasts until they were trussed up and presented, nipples bulging like cherries atop plump Christmas puddings...”

As with anything penned by the amazing KD Grace, The Pet Shop is an essential addition to any collection in the eroticists’ library. Buy it, read it, enjoy it, and then do it all again.

Published by Xcite as an e-book, The Pet Shop will also be released as a paperback in October 2011. Available from Xcite, Amazon UK, Amazon US, and all leading book and Kindle retailers.
